Mayor Treviño issues emergency advisory for Hamilton Senior Apartments air conditioning

LAREDO, Tex. (KGNS) - Mayor Dr. Victor Treviño issued an emergency advisory for the Hamilton Senior Apartments Complex, where elderly residents have been without air conditioning during the summer season.The emergency declaration steps up the city’s emergency readiness and directs the city manage...
Key takeaway The mayor said a full replacement of the building’s chiller is estimated at around $1 million.
